ACFI starts campaign to promote quality agri inputs
Telangana Agriculture and Cooperation Minister Singireddy Niranjan Reddy has launched a campaign initiated by the Agro Chem Federation of India (ACFI) that seeks to promote the use of quality agricultural inputs (agrochemicals).
The minister announced 10 mobile trucks as part of a campaign titled “Jago Kisan Jago” to raise awareness among farmers about the role of high quality agricultural inputs to improve yields and farm income.
It also aims to tell farmers how important it is to have proper invoices to ensure the purchase of high quality agricultural inputs.
“These mobile trucks will disseminate important information about the use of quality pesticides to farmers. They will educate farmers about modern agricultural techniques, and stress the importance of purchasing agricultural inputs with proper billing,” said RG Agarwal, Chair of the Advisory Committee, ACFI.
ACFI has organized similar campaigns in Haryana and Maharashtra.
